ABOUT PROVIDENCE FALLS: THIEF OF FATE:
Detectives Cora and Liam close in on solving their murder case and rebel against the angels, choosing to take fate into their own hands.
AIR DATE & NETWORK FOR PROVIDENCE FALLS: THIEF OF FATE:
August 16, 2025 | Hallmark Channel
CAST & CREW OF PROVIDENCE FALLS: THIEF OF FATE:
Katie Stevens as Cora McLeod
Lachlan Quarmby as Liam O’Conner
Evan Roderick as Finn
Niall Matter as Bael
Matty Finochio as Chief Boyd
Paul McGillion as James McLeod
Felicia Simone as Suzette Deveraux
BRAN'S PROVIDENCE FALLS: THIEF OF FATE SYNOPSIS:
Cora is dreaming of olden times with Liam. She wakes up in the hospital room and tells her dad and Suzette about what she remembers.
Agon is at a bar when Bael comes to sit down next to him. Bael lights his drink on fire and tells him he’s just here to give the humans a choice. Clearly, this Bael is up to no good.
He then goes to talk to Suzette. He tells her her job isn’t done yet—and that he knows she’s developing a little crush on Finn. He tells her to use it.
Cora gets home and is surprised to see Liam. When she walks inside, she finds the house filled with flowers—all from him.
Meanwhile, Finn is at Suzette’s coffee shop. They talk about the unmistakable bond between Liam and Cora, even as sparks begin to fly between Finn and Suzette.
Cora returns to work, where she and Liam are focused on the case. Guess who shows up as Magnus’s lawyer? Bael—and he’s very good. After the meeting, Bael tells Liam there’s always another side, if he’s interested.
Liam wants to tap Magnus’s phone, even though it’s not exactly legal. That won’t stop him.
Later, Cora invites Liam over for Italian food and wine. Naturally, it ends with him pulling her chair closer and just gazing into each others eyes until Liam needs to leave.
Liam asks Suzette to help clone Magnus’s phone, and she does. When Cora finds out, she’s furious.
Her dreams about Liam from the old days keep intensifying, until she finally confronts him. Liam comes clean—about Limbo, angels, reincarnation, all of it. And he tells her the hardest truth of all: her destiny only happens with Finn.
Meanwhile, Finn shoots his shot with Suzette, asking her out on a date to Seattle. They’re about to kiss when she gets a text—the cloned phone has a new message. They do kiss before he leaves. The message? Magnus is supposed to meet someone at the state park in ten minutes.
When Liam and Cora get there, they find Magnus dead—and Finn missing.
She’s worried about him, but then she gets a text: Finn has already gone ahead to Seattle and will be back in a couple weeks for his stuff. Cora thinks it’s suspicious. When they go to check, Finn is gone. Agon appears and realizes Cora knows the truth. Liam begs for just a little more time to find him.
They confront Suzette, who admits she’s been working with the other side in hopes of earning a clean slate. But she also admits she’s started to care for Finn.
Long story short—Chief Boyd turns out to be a baddie. They catch him smuggling from a mine where they also find Finn. Chief Boyd tries to shoot Finn, but Liam jumps in front of the bullet.
At that moment, Brendan Penny appears. He declares that it’s clear these two can change—and that they should be allowed to choose their own soulmates. Liam and Cora seal it with a kiss.
Fast forward one year: Cora’s nonprofit is expanding, she and Liam are married, Finn and Suzette are together—and Cora and Liam share even more kisses.
